推荐开源项目:Python机器学习蓝图
在这个快速发展的数据科学时代,Python已经成为了机器学习领域的主流语言。而【Python机器学习蓝图】项目,是你的理想起点,无论你是初学者还是经验丰富的开发者,都能从中找到创新的灵感和实用的技术方案。
项目介绍
这个开源项目源自Packt出版的同名书籍,它提供了一整套用于实践的代码样本,涵盖了从基础到高级的各类机器学习应用场景。通过这些实例,你可以逐步深入理解Python在机器学习中的应用,并提升你的技能水平。
项目技术分析
项目采用Python 3.5作为基础环境,配合Anaconda科学计算库,确保了代码的一站式运行。特别是在第三章,项目引入了PhantomJS进行无头浏览器操作,展示了如何在Web抓取和数据分析中结合机器学习。这不仅展现了Python生态的丰富性,也揭示了现代机器学习系统的构建方式。
项目及技术应用场景
这个项目的设计意图广泛,包括但不限于:
- 数据预处理:学习如何清洗、转换和规范化数据,为机器学习模型准备输入。
- 监督学习:实践分类和回归任务,例如使用决策树、随机森林和神经网络解决实际问题。
- 非监督学习:探索聚类和降维技术,揭示数据隐藏的结构和模式。
- 强化学习:了解如何让AI通过与环境的交互来学习最优策略。
这些应用场景涵盖了许多行业,如金融预测、市场分析、图像识别以及自然语言处理等。
项目特点
- 易上手:项目提供了清晰的步骤指导,即便是没有深厚背景的读者也能跟随教程进行操作。
- 实用性:每个示例都针对具体问题设计,能帮助你理解机器学习的实际应用价值。
- 跨平台:支持Mac OS X, Windows, 或者Linux操作系统,适用范围广泛。
- 资源丰富:除了本书,还推荐了其他相关的Python学习资料和视频课程,为持续学习提供路径。
总的来说,【Python机器学习蓝图】是一个全面且富有启发性的学习资源,它将带你深入探索机器学习的世界,助你在实践中成长。如果你渴望掌握Python机器学习并打造自己的智能解决方案,那么这个项目绝对不容错过!现在就加入,开启你的探索之旅吧!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考